Here’s a schedule of week 4 of the National Football League. In Thursday night’s game, the St. Louis Rams couldn’t withstand the pounding of the San Francisco 49ers, who prevailed in a 35-11 victory. There are eight early games starting Sunday morning at 1:00 Eastern, followed by four late afternoon games at starting at 4:05. Sunday Night Football’s featured game is New England at Atlanta Falcons at 8:30 Eastern on NBC. Both Green Bay and Carolina have a bye this week.
